World Council of Churches says “non-violent action and peaceful dialogue” only way to end Syrian conflict following US bombing
The World Council of Churches has renewed its calls for all parties to the Syrian conflict to cease hostilities and “commit to peaceful negotiations toward a transitional governance within the framework of international law” in the wake of the US bombing of a Syrian airfield, saying there is no military solution to the crisis. US launches missile attack on Syrian airbase linked to chemical attack
The US has launched a missile attack on an airfield in Syria in response to the chemical weapons attack in the country’s Idlib province this week. World Council of Churches calls for end to “culture of impunity” in Syria following chemical gas attack
The World Council of Churches has added their voice to those condemning the chemical weapons attack in Syria’s Idlib province this week, saying it was time to end the “culture of impunity” in the country and the surrounding region.
